Output ddf6680227623ae9fa129969d2f00aa433a41f5617eb71d97a49e4093473b5af: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 92563598512c3a667fcbe6cd1a2fa2300656610b6013978efa4d4149a4172815
address
tb1pjftrtxz39saxvl7tumx35tazxqr9vcgtvqfe0rh6f4q5nfqh9q2s0kf5gz
transaction
ddf6680227623ae9fa129969d2f00aa433a41f5617eb71d97a49e4093473b5af
confirmations
59990
spent
false

1 Sat Range